Aranesp (darbepoetin alfa) by Amgen Found Ineffective and Dangerous

Many patients being treated for various cancers develop anemia. Aranesp is approved by the FDA for the treatment of patients with anemia, which is caused by chemotherapy treatment of their malignant disease, rather than the underlying malignant disease itself. Essentially, it is a toxic drug which attempts to overcome some of the damage caused by other far more toxic drugs.

Amgen, the maker of Aranesp, conducted a large, multicenter, randomized, placebo-controlled study that showed Aranesp was ineffective in reducing red blood cell transfusions or fatigue in patients with cancer who have anemia that is not due to concurrent chemotherapy. The study also showed higher mortality in patients receiving Aranesp.

What are you doing about osteoporosis?

As we noted earlier, the US Food and Drug Administration (FDA) is considering updating what it will allow as a health claim related to calcium for osteoporosis. If you read that article you'll recall my scepticism about their motivation and intentions. Nevertheless, they are correct in their acceptance of the critical role played by associated nutrients in the absorption and utilization of calcium.

Remember, for the calcium to benefit your bones, it must be ingested (you have to eat or drink it), absorbed (from you gastrointestinal tract into your blood stream) and finally assimilated (taken into the boney tissue where it can be utilized). You must also maintain a required amount of calcium circulating in your blood to meet the needs of cells throughout your body, notably skeletal and cardiac muscle cells. Failure to do so will prevent calcium from being used to build or rebuild bone because when blood levels drop you automatically draw calcium from bone to help ensure adequate cellular function.
